I’ve been 5 times and this was the first time without us being there. The atmosphere was definitely different. Also, the merchandise area sucked arse compared to every other year. Someone usually had LSU hats or shirts but there wasn’t one to be found. Come to find out, a lawyer we hung around at the tailgate said the NCAA took over all of the merchandise area and it could only be licensed NCAA apparel and then jacked up the prices. While walking down 10th street we noticed a group of tents and an LSU one included. We went in and that guy was one of the tents that used to setup across from the field. He said they’d been selling merchandise for 20 years(including at the old stadium) and they got kicked out from their old spot because some of his stuff wasn’t licensed. Most of it looked better than the licensed shite!
